We are now abra Web & Mobile.  

Learn more

Complex System & App Development

Israel's leading companies use abra Web & Mobile to develop apps and complex systems for a wide range of industries. Want to learn more about the app development process? You've come to the right place.

A few words about complex system and app development

Want to develop an app, a complex system, a dashboard or a reporting system that can help your organization reach its objectives and penetrate new markets? We're here to help. We'll be happy to tell you more about the app development process. Here goes!

It's All About the Process

The main app development stages are planning, design, UX/UI, front-end development, back-end development, development documentation, QA, delivery and training. We can't stress how important it is to conduct an orderly and fully transparent process. Trust us: it's more important than anything else.

For example, let's take the mobile app development process. The first step is system planning and characterization. During this stage, we select the app's development framework and decide whether to create a hybrid app or a native app. We'll also plan a timeframe for the project and put together the amazing team who will work on your project. We'll ask a ton of important questions that are relevant to your app's key objectives, your users' desired behaviors, and more. Our goal is to cover as much ground as possible, in order to eliminate surprises during the development process.

As soon as we are done with this first stage, the project manager will make sure to establish a detailed work plan that includes a Gantt chart and a timeline that incorporate all project components. We will then commence to hand the baton over to our creative studio, who will take care of the app's UX/UI design. Once our creative guys and girls complete their jobs, we'll deliver the project to your dedicated development team, who will commence with front-end and back-end development. The entire process is closely monitored by our QA team, who conduct a wide range of manual and automatic tests that identify and fix bugs.

The most exciting stage is the delivery stage. Your app is alive, and is performing to perfection. Congrats!

Where Do We Go from Here?

App development is our expertise, and satisfied clients are our obsession. We'll be happy to meet with you, tell you more about our company and think about a possible collaboration. Let's talk!

Our Secret: Simplifying A Complicated Process

App development is a world of its own. There are simple apps, and then there are large and complicated apps. Our goal is to transform even the most complex processes – that include applications for different audiences, multi-layered architecture and a multitude of functions – into simple experiences. How can this be done? The answer is expectation alignment, full transparency, and clear objectives for every step along the way.

How Do You Fit In? We're Glad You Asked!

At abra Web & Mobile, app development is more than just a process. It's a relationship. In fact, you are our full partners every step of the way. Everything we do is fully transparent, from our choices to their implementation. Your dedicated project manager is available at all times (but try not to call at the middle of the night…) and will happily answer any question or conduct a spontaneous brainstorming session. We are in this together, from the initial planning stages to the final QA tests. Why are we telling you all this? Because we believe that clear and direct communication is the key to success. It's worked for us so far!

Take Sugar in Your Coffee?

Let’s schedule a call or get together over coffee and Snacks. 0% commitment on your end, 100% attention on ours.